uncensored

/ʌnˈsɛnsərd/
adjective
  1. Not subjected to censorship; having no material removed or suppressed, especially for political or moral reasons.
    • The website provides uncensored access to historical documents.
    • The uncensored version of the film includes scenes that were cut from the theatrical release.
    • Journalists fought for the right to publish uncensored news reports.
  2. Not restrained or filtered; expressed freely and openly.
    • He gave an uncensored account of his travels, including the difficult parts.
    • The comedian's uncensored routine shocked some audience members.
    • Her uncensored opinions often got her into trouble at work.
